Energy Project RFP Alert - US FL - Department Of The Air Force Bid - Air Force Energy Savings

Alert Type:
Bid

Description:
The purpose of this Industry Event is to provide Energy Service Companies (ESCOs) and Utility Providers the opportunity to furnish feedback to senior Air Force leaders on their efforts to assist the AF with meeting mandated energy conservation goals. The Industry Event will be held on Monday, November 26, 2012 at the Tyndall AFB Horizons Community Activity Center, building 1550, Tyndall AFB, FL. The event will be held from 12:00 p.m. until 4:00 p.m. in Ballroom A. The Honorable Terry A. Yonkers, the Assistant Secretary of the Air Force for Installations, Environment & Logistics will provide kick-off remarks followed by Mr Timothy Unruh, Program Manager for DoE's Federal Energy Management Program. The Air Force will then present an overview of their ESPC and UESC programs. The majority of the afternoon will be reserved for the ESCOs and Utility Providers to provide feedback and suggestions on how the Air Force might improve and expedite the ESPC and UESC processes, break logjams and increase the number of AF opportunities. Due to the planned forum and venue, the Air Force requests that only one attendee from each firm plan to attend, if possible, but no more than two.

Energy Project RFP Alert - US NY - Nys Energy Research And Development Authority PON - Pon 2629 - Improving Energy Efficiency

Alert Type:
PON

Description:
NYSERDA seeks proposals to: (1) research the use of light emitting diode (LED) supplementary lighting in controlled environment agriculture (CEA) as an energy efficient alternative to other lighting technologies; (2) demonstrate innovative applications of technologies that reduce electric, heating, cooling, water demands or other environmental parameters associated with CEA operation; or (3) develop an online ‘virtual greenhouse’ simulation model for vegetable crops.
